Company Owned Intellectual Property definition

Company Owned Intellectual Property means all Intellectual Property owned or purported to be owned by the Company or a Subsidiary, in whole or in part.
Company Owned Intellectual Property means the Intellectual Property that is owned by the Company, including Intellectual Property owned by the Company that is included in the Transferred Assets.
Company Owned Intellectual Property means all Intellectual Property Rights that are owned or purported to be owned by the Group Companies.

Examples of Company Owned Intellectual Property in a sentence

  • All assignments to the Company or any of its Subsidiaries of Company Registered IP that is Company Owned Intellectual Property have been properly executed and recorded.

  • Schedule 4.14.14 sets forth all assignment agreements by which Company Owned Intellectual Property was assigned to the Acquired Company by an employee, independent contractor, or other third party.

  • To the Knowledge of Seller, except as would not, individually or in the aggregate, reasonably be expected to have a Material Adverse Effect, all fees due as of the Closing Date associated with maintaining any registered Company Owned Intellectual Property have been paid in full in a timely manner to the proper Governmental Authority, and all filings required as of the Closing Date associated with maintaining any registered Company Owned Intellectual Property have been made.

  • The Company has never (i) transferred ownership of, or granted any exclusive license (except as set forth in Section 3.12(e) of the Disclosure Schedule) with respect to, any Company Owned Intellectual Property to any other Person in the last four (4) years, or (ii) permitted the rights of the Company in any Company Owned Intellectual Property, that is or was at the time material to the Company, to enter into the public domain.

  • Except as set forth on Section 3.12(m) of the Disclosure Schedule, no funding, facilities or resources of any government, university, college, other educational institution, multi-national, bi-national or international organization or research center was used in the development of the Company Products, Company Software or Company Owned Intellectual Property.
